D345 RGC is a 1987 Honda CG125 in Black with a 124c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 55.6%.
Across all 1987 Honda CG125 models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.3% with a typical mileage of 24,136 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Honda CG125 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th is below minimum requirements of 1.0mm, accounting for 2,338 recorded failures. If you're considering buying D345 RGC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Honda CG125 typically stays on UK roads for around 44 years. At 39 years old, this Honda CG125 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
